Messari conducted a comparative study between Chainlink and XRP Ledger to assess their appeal to enterprise capital and regulated finance.
Chainlink is positioned as a foundational connectivity layer underpinning over $20 trillion in on-chain value, focusing on secure data delivery and cross-chain messaging, with the Chainlink Runtime Environment facilitating bespoke oracle workflows.
XRP Ledger emphasizes sub-second settlement, tokenization, and regulated DeFi, but faces legal uncertainties due to Ripple's ongoing legal battle with the SEC.
Financially, Chainlink's market cap is lower than XRP's, yet its token value is significantly higher, indicating differences in monetization strategies, while partnership momentum blurs the lines between the two networks.
